Программа для прошивки транзистор тестера
Здравствуйте. Уже прошло пол года с момента покупки LCR T4 и он не перестает выручать своей многофункциональностью в практике радиолюбителя. Но оказывается этот прибор может намного большее, надо просто немного ему помочь.
Для начала кто не в курсе что за прибор, рекомендую прочитать статью Тестер ESR -T4 метр Mega328.На ютубе попалось как то видео с доработкой подобного прибора. После прошивки ESR T4 научился проверять стабилитроны, добавился генератор прямоугольных импульсов, а так же добавилась возможность измерять емкость и ESR конденсаторов не выпаивая их с платы. Ради последнего я и решился переделать свой мультиметр. Собрав побольше информации на форумах и ютубе о переделке, принялся за работу.
Для прошивки контролера был заказан самый дешевый AVR программатор USB ASP за 85 рублей.
Так же был найден драйвер для него и ПО для прошивки AVRDUDE
Оказывается разновидностей похожих приборов много и существует большой архив подборка прошивок, схем и прочей полезной мелочи. Из всех перечисленных моделей я нашел свою версию LCR-T4(T3)NoStripGrid. Эта версия, с должной доработкой, умеет мерить частоту и напряжение, но эти функции пользовать не буду, для этого у меня есть мультиметр UNIT UT136B. Что бы не потерять архив, добавил к себе на ЯндексДиск, вот ссылка. Так же ссылка на драйвер программатора и приложение
Для прошивки отключаю питание от платы и подготовил схему распиновка контактов подключения программатора.
Так же добавлю схему всего мультиметра, на всякий случай
Теперь нахожу соответствующие выводы на программаторе с помощью мультиметра и припаиваю проводки на свое место. На программаторе все контакты подписаны, что облегчает поиск
После подключения программатора к ноутбуку, виндовс сам дрова не поставил. Для установки драйвера зашел в диспетчер задач и через него установил дрова. Ссылка на дрова и прогу AVR DUDE
Теперь запущу AVR DUDE и первым делом выставлю фузы по примеру
Теперь сохраню оригинальные прошивки флешки и памяти Eprom. Микроконтроллер нужно выбрать ATmega328P, а программатор USBASP.
Теперь выберу прошивку для своего мультиметра и нажму на прошивку флешки и Eprom
После прошивки флешки на экране появилось изображение, но ничего не понятно.
Прошью Eprom и посмотрю что получиться.
Подключаю плату к питальнику 9В и креплю все в корпус, кстати корпус пришел пару дней назад. Питается от аккумулятора Li-ion через повышающий преобразователь, аккумулятор заряжается через модуль зарядки 4,2В 1А от USB порта.
Первый пуск прошел удачно, но контрастности совсем не хватало. Долгим нажатием на кнопку запустил меню, короткими нажатиями нашел в меню контрастность и длинным нажатием выбрал раздел контрастность. Нажимал кнопку до тех пор пока изображение на экране не стало максимально хорошо видно.
Теперь пора сделать калибровку. Калибровка запускается с того же меню. При запуске прибор попросит закоротить 3 вывода.
Теперь прибор просит извлечь перемычку.
Дальше надо вставить конденсатор более 100 нФ, я поставил 220нФ.
Следом прибор попросит установить кондер 10-30нФ, я поставлю 10нФ.
Через пару секунд прибор напишет что тест успешно закончен . Так же покажет версию прошивку, в моем случае 1,13K
Теперь можно пользоваться прибором. В принципе старые функции выглядят и запускаются так же. На примере транзистор
Но прибор был прошит для расширения функционала, поэтому рассмотрим что нового появилось.
Первая это генератор прямоугольника. Сколько не гонял вроде стабильно работает, больше 100кГц не проверял потому что осциллограф не поддерживает. Подробней о нем написано в статье Осциллограф DSO138.Сборка и настройка
Вторая функция это 10-битный ШИМ регулятор , куда нибудь да пригодиться
Далее те функции которые хотел, это проверка конденсаторов не выпаивая с платы. Проверяю конденсатор 220мкФ 200В. Для удобства изготовил щупы из старых щупов для мультиметра
Далее похожая функция проверки индуктивности, проверяю трансформатора для нового проекта
Ну и на этом пожалуй все. Баловался с прибором долго, много компонентов проверил и в принципе результатом доволен.
Теперь список всего что было в статье перечислено. Все заказывал с Китая, Ведь там в три раза дешевле. Если не грузиться страница, попробуйте повторно нажать на ссылку
Программатор USBASP стоимостью 85 рублей
Мультиметр LCR -T4 стоил всего 644 рублей
Корпус для мультиметра LCR T-4 копеечный за 196 рублей
Модуль для зарядки Li-ION от USB порта 1А за 19 рублей
Повышающий модуль с 3,7В до 9В стоит всего 32 рубля
А так же ссылка на мультиметр UNIT за 1100 рублей участвующий в настройке, а так же ссылка на осциллограф за 1350 рублей, которым проверял генератор.
Вроде ничего не забыл. Теперь в мастерской еще один качественный прибор за 1000 рублей для любительской практики
Тестер ESR-T4 вполне востребован в практике радиолюбителя. Но однажды проверка неразряженного электролитического конденсатора приказала ему долго жить. Лечится это заменой ATmega328P с последующей прошивкой. Заодно после прошивки ESR-T4 научился проверять стабилитроны, добавился генератор прямоугольных импульсов, а также добавилась возможность измерять емкость и ESR конденсаторов, не выпаивая их с платы.
Для прошивки контролера был заказан самый дешевый AVR программатор USB ASP, например такой как на фото. Покупаем комплект с переходником.
Также был найден драйвер для него и ПО для прошивки AVRDUDE (скачать).
1. Запустить _AVRDUDE_PROG, выбрать ATmega328P
2. Указать путь к TransistorTester.hex файлу (не должно быть русских букв в пути).
3. Указать путь к TransistorTester.eep файлу (не должно быть русских букв в пути).
4. Выставить фьюзы. Не бойтесь запороть процессор. Если думаете, что накосячили, нажмите по умолчанию. Потом выставить фьюзы по картинке. Перед програмирование прочитайте про два самых опасных фьюза. Их ни в коем случае не меняйте. Иначе без высоковольтного программатора не разблокируете. Остальные можно менять сколько угодно.
Фьюзы инверсные !
Я не смог снять неактивные галочки по умолчанию и подобрал рабочую версию под себя. В оригинале фьюзы выставлены так:
5. Подключить программатор USBASP. На моем приборе не было контактов под разъем программатора, запаиваем их так, чтобы выводы были со стороны микропроцессора. На моем приборе надписи контактов с противоположной стороны, что неудобно.
Нажимаем "Чтение" возле НЕХ, если считалось - есть связь с программатором.
На моем программаторе закорочены выводы JP3 (иначе новая микросхема не прошьется, по умолчанию у нее низкая частота), JP21 в положении 3,3 Вольта.
6. Открыть вкладку Program
9. Перейти на вкладку Fuses. Нажать "Программирование" (залить фьюзы).
Отключаем и пользуемся.
P.S. При первом включении маленькая контрастность. Длинное нажатие кнопку, вход в меню. Выбираем коротким нажатием "контрастность", выставляем 55. Короткое нажатие это минус единица, длинное - плюс единица.
Калибруем и сохраняем калибровку.
Калибровка запускается с того-же меню. При запуске прибор попросит закоротить 3 вывода. Закоротить контакты для старта. Теперь прибор просит извлечь перемычку.
Нужно вытащить перемычку. Дальше надо вставить конденсатор более 100 нФ, я поставил 150 нФ.
Установка конденсатора более 100 нФ
Следом прибор попросит установить конденсатор 10-30 нФ, я поставлю 20 нФ. Через пару секунд прибор напишет что тест успешно закончен. Также покажет версию прошивку, в моем случае 1,13K.
Завершение теста. Теперь можно пользоваться прибором. Автор статьи - NIK 777.
Форум по обсуждению материала ПРОШИВКА И РЕМОНТ LCR-T4 T3 NOSTRIPGRID
Мощный транзистор BLF147 - вот основа схемы самодельного усилителя УКВ диапазона.
Увеличение мощности интегральных усилителей транзисторами. Рассматривается на примере схем LM3886 и TDA7294.
Используйте технологию дополненной реальности, чтобы легко ремонтировать и отлаживать радиоэлектронные проекты в онлайн режиме.
Обзор возможностей комплекта бесконтактного модуля считывателя карт RFID RDM6300. Подключение схемы и тесты.
Учимся ремонтировать кинескопные, LED и ЖК телевизоры вместе.
07.02.2017 Lega95 5 Комментариев
Всем привет. В сегодняшней статье расмотрим то, как можно перепрошить свой ESR метр DIY 328 на новую прошивку, с поддержкой русского языка. Процесс оказался не сложным, а результат очень хорошим.
Для Вашего удобства, статью разделил на разделы.
Содержание статьи
О программаторе
Программатор я заказал в Китае по смешной цене, меньше двух долларов. Покупал здесь . Дошел до пункта назначения за 16 дней.
Программатор с ISP кабелем
Собран программатор на микросхеме ATMEGA 8a. В комплекте идет ISP кабель.
Все выводы разъемов подписаны, что очень упрощает работу.
Подписи на разъемах
Так-же, на программаторе есть перемычка, для переключения питания программируемой микросхемы. В нашем случае, микросхема ESR метра ATmega 328p питается от напряжения 5 вольт, так что перемычку оставляем в положении 5 вольт.
Подготовка ESR метра к прошивке.
Первым делом, необходимо вынуть аккумулятор, или в моем случае отпаять его от платы.
подпайка проводов для прошивки к ESR метру.
Для фиксации, просунул их в отверстия для подключения щупов, и немного приклеил тонким скотчем.
Далее, подключил все к кабелю ISP программатора.
подключение к ISP разъему
Разобраться очень легко, на картинке видно по цветам какой провод куда подключать.
Дампы прошивок и программа для программатора
Я подготовил архив, который Вы можете скачать ниже:
DIV328.rar (unknown, 13 608 hits)
Содержимое Вам необходимо распаковать в любое удобное Вам место на компьютере. Я использовал корень диска C:\. Немного о содержимом.
Установка драйвера программатора
программатор без драйвера
поиск драйверов на компьютере
Выбираем путь, где разархивирована папка с программой, заходим в папку Drivers_USBasp, далее libusb_1.2.4.0 и нажимаем ок.
Появится окно с нужным драйвером.
После установки получаем новое устройство в диспетчере задач.
На этом драйвер можно считать установленным.
Настаиваем программу и прошиваем ESR метр
Запускаем программу AVRDUDEPROG. После этого, необходимо сделать маленькие настройки. По идее, программа должна уже быть настроена, но Вам лучше проверить настройки обведенные красными кругами.
Выберите свои пути для прошивки flash и памяти. Обязательно правильно выберите файлы. Flash файлы имеют расширение .hex а памяти (Eprom) .epp.
Все остальные настройки я не трогал, микросхему программатор определил сразу. Сначала прошиваем Flash, после этого Eprom.
Процесс прошивки флеш
Удачное завершение прошивки
Калибровка прибора
После прошивки, прибор необходимо откалибровать. Для этого, необходимо закоротить все 3 щупа между собой, и нажать тест.
Заключение
После перепрошивки получаем совсем другой прибор. Что мне нравится в новой прошивке, так это скорость работы прибора. Все работает намного быстрее, добавлена возможность проверки стабилитронов до 5 вольт, намного лучше измеряется индуктивность. Результатом я доволен. Позже добавлю фото работы, и примеры измерений.
Пример отображения пунктов меню
Ссылки на детали:
Программатор
ESR метр
Файл с программой и прошивками:
DIV328.rar (unknown, 13 608 hits)
запасная ссылкаОбзор ESR метра
При неполадках электронной аппаратуры, значительная часть отказов, бывает по вине испортившихся электролитических конденсаторов. Это может быть, как высыхание со временем таких конденсаторов, и соответственно снижение их емкости, (особенно этим славились советские электролитические конденсаторы), так и увеличением их ЭПС, эквивалентного последовательного сопротивления (по английски называется ESR). При этом на верхней части конденсатора образуется вздутие. Происходит это часто от перегрева, как пример можно привести конденсаторы, стоящие в материнских платах рядом с радиатором процессора. Но иногда, на ранних стадиях, это вздувание может быть незаметно на глаз, но устройство из-за этого может уже не работать. В таких случаях для измерения нужен специальный прибор, ЭПС (ESR) метр.
Такие приборы могут проверять оксидные конденсаторы, как с выпаиванием, так и без выпаивания из платы. Так как при измерении важны даже десятые доли Ома, такие приборы имеют короткие щупы, или конденсаторы вставляются выводами прямо в панельку прибора. Долгое время колебался, собрать самому подобный прибор, или купить готовый, пока не наткнулся на Али экспресс, на один из лотов, по нормальной цене, многофункциональный прибор, Транзистор тестер с графическим дисплеем. Стоил такой прибор 12,23 доллара.
Данный прибор, копия немецкого прибора от Маркуса. Существует множество версий китайских клонов под разные дисплеи, и с небольшими отличиями в схемах. Но все они основаны на оригинальной схеме. Для того чтобы заказать такой прибор, достаточно набрать приведенный ниже текст:
Прибор позволяет проверять множество различных радиодеталей, перечисление их займет много времени, он меряет емкость, ESR, индуктивность, сопротивление, проверяет диоды, транзисторы, тиристоры, и много чего еще. Желающие ознакомиться с полным списком возможностей могут прочитать подробную инструкцию на русском языке, находящуюся в прикрепленном общем архиве. Ниже приведена принципиальная схема данного прибора, в хорошем разрешении:
Схема тестера
Китайцы заливают в прибор свою прошивку, которую защищают от копирования, но прибор можно спокойно перешить прошивкой от автора прибора, и их дальнейшими модификациями. В том числе и русифицированной прошивкой, один из вариантов русифицированной прошивки выложил в прикрепленном архиве. Для перепрошивания микроконтроллера, на плате выведены шесть отверстий, куда можно спокойно подпаяться МГТФ-ом, и подключить программатор. Распиновка разъема приведена на принципиальной схеме, дальше можно сориентироваться относительно контактов земли и + 5 вольт. Прибор сделан на микроконтроллере AVR Mega 328P. Так выглядел мой прибор:
На обратной стороне платы расположены микроконтроллер и все остальные детали. На следующем фото изображен прибор, вид сзади:
После того как прибор пришел, возникла необходимость оформить его в корпусе. Как назло, под рукой не было ничего подходящего. На одном из интернет ресурсов, наткнулся на фото, изображающее использование в качестве корпуса, подкассетника от аудиокассеты. Выбирать было не из чего, и я решил повторить чужой опыт. Взял подкассетник, с помощью резака из ножовочного полотна, сделал необходимые вырезы:
Проблема была в том, что батарея крона, по ширине не помещалась в подкассетник, пришлось пойти на довольно колхозное решение, сделать батарею выступающей из корпуса. Если кто-нибудь захочет повторить мой опыт изготовления корпуса, хочу предупредить что оргстекло довольно хрупкий материал, и при малейшем не аккуратном действии при обработке, норовит пойти трещинами. Так выглядел тестер после сборки в корпусе:
Изготовление переходника
Для калибровки воспользовался пленочным конденсатором. Далее захотел сделать переходник для подключения выводных деталей. Выпаял три пина с материнской платы, как на фото ниже:
У меня был в наличии набор цветных проводков с крокодилами с обоих концов, заказанный ранее на Али экспресс. Взял и обрезал крокодилы с одного конца, зачистил и подпаял проводки к пинам. Аккуратно упаковал в термоусадку во избежание замыкания, и залил получившийся разъем термоклеем для придания прочности. Так выглядел разъем после изготовления:
Длина проводков позволяет удобно подключаться к выводам проверяемой детали. Так выглядел готовый переходник:
Также в интернете существуют модификации прибора с частотомером, генератором частоты, проверкой энкодера, тестированием стабилитронов, и другими расширенными возможностями. В выложенной в архиве прошивке (у меня залита такая-же) эти возможности предусмотрены, но только после апгрейда прибора. Их можно не задействовать. Для использования расширенных функций, придется перерезать дорожки и паять детали навесом. Я решил, что мне пока будет достаточно функционала прибора в настоящем виде. На всякий случай, приведу одну из скачанных мной схем, расширения функционала прибора с поддержкой энкодера:
В данном приборе используется подключение дисплея strip grid, на случай если кто-либо захочет продолжить поиск информации в интернете, по апгрейду прибора. Фьюзы при перепрошивании изменять не нужно. Так выглядит меню после перепрошивания:
Читайте также: